When planning a garden in Topeka, it's important to consider the city's climate. Topeka is located in USDA Hardiness Zone 6b, which means that you need to choose plants that can withstand the specific temperature ranges and seasonal variations of this area to ensure your garden flourishes.

Selecting the right plants for your Topeka cottage garden involves considering its USDA Hardiness Zone 6b. Choose varieties that are known to thrive in this region, and that fit the relaxed, natural look of a cottage garden. Here are some suggestions to get you started.
English Lavender offers fragrant blooms and is perfect for creating borders or accents in cottage gardens in Topeka, Kansas.
Coneflowers are drought-tolerant and attract pollinators, making them ideal for a Topeka cottage garden.
These vibrant perennials bring a splash of color and are low-maintenance, perfect for cottage gardens in Zone 6b.
Hostas thrive in shaded areas and provide lush, green foliage, great for creating depth in a Kansas garden design.
Peonies offer stunning, fragrant blossoms that enhance the romance of a cottage garden in Topeka, KS.
Shasta Daisies are cheerful and hardy, making them a reliable choice for cottage gardens in Topeka.
This grass adds vertical interest and is very resilient, ideal for Topeka's cottage gardens.
Blue Fescue offers a unique color and texture, perfect for adding contrast in your cottage garden.
Northern Sea Oats have beautiful seed heads that add movement and interest to any garden in Topeka, KS.
Redbud trees are known for their stunning spring blossoms and are a classic addition to cottage gardens in Topeka.
Dogwoods produce beautiful flowers and have an elegant form, perfect for Kansas garden design.
Serviceberry trees provide multi-season interest with flowers, fruits, and fall color, ideal for cottage gardens in Topeka.
